A particle moving with kinetic energy E has de Broglie wavelength λ . If energy ΔE is added to its energy, the wavelength become λ2 . Value of ΔE, is:
  1. E
  2. 4E
  3. 3E
  4. 2E

Solution

λ=h2KEmλ1KE
λλ2=KEfKEi
4KEi=KEf
ΔE=4KEi-KEi=3KE=3E
